ORDER
THIS MATTER is before the Court on Defendant The Hanover
Insurance Company’s Motion to Dismiss [Doc. 22] and the Magistrate
Judge’s Memorandum and Recommendation [Doc. 33] regarding the
disposition of that motion.
Pursuant to 28 U.S.C. § 636(b) and the standing Orders of
Designation of this Court, the Honorable Dennis L. Howell, United States
Magistrate Judge, was designated to consider the motion to dismiss and to
submit a recommendation for its disposition.
On February 4, 2013, the Magistrate Judge filed a Memorandum and
Recommendation in this case containing proposed conclusions of law in
support of a recommendation regarding the Defendant’s motion. [Doc. 33].
The parties were advised that any objections to the Magistrate Judge’s
Memorandum and Recommendation were to be filed in writing within
fourteen (14) days of service. The period within which to file objections has
expired,
and
no
written
objections
to
the
Memorandum
and
Recommendation have been filed.
After a careful review of the Magistrate Judge’s Recommendation
[Doc. 33], the Court finds that the proposed conclusions of law are
consistent with current case law. Accordingly, the Court hereby accepts
the Magistrate Judge’s Recommendation that the Defendant’s Motion to
Dismiss should be granted and that Counts Three and Five of the Plaintiff’s
Amended Complaint should be dismissed.
ORDER
IT IS, THEREFORE, ORDERED that the Memorandum and
Recommendation [Doc. 33] is ACCEPTED and the Defendant’s Motion to
Dismiss [Doc. 22] is GRANTED. Counts Three and Five of the Plaintiff’s
Amended Complaint are hereby DISMISSED.
